      In the 2015-16 school year, 75 percent of Chicago Public Schools (CPS) ninth-graders opted out of their assigned high school. These students could choose from more than 300 programs at 138 public high schools.       (98.8%) are operating school districts. Fall Enrollment Public school enrollment has registered a 1.9 percent increase from 2008‒09 (48,954,071 ) to 2017‒18 (49,878,713). Enrollment in elementary schools has increased by 2.4 percent, whereas enrollment in secondary schools has increased by 1.0 percent during the 10-year period.

      The School Quality Rating Policy (SQRP) is the district's policy for evaluating each school's academic performance each year. The rating on this report is based on how the school performed in the 2016-2017 school year, and it is used to determine the school's accountability status for the 2017-2018 school year.
